Council backtracks on outside smoking ban (Publican)

Plans to stop smoking outside bars in Barnsley have been ditched following a meeting between the council and trade representatives. Members of the British Beer & Pub Association (BBPA), the FLVA and Barnsley LVA met with the leader of Barnsley Council today to discuss outside smoking ban proposals.
